Compact Fuse Socket Designs
Particular demand for miniaturized electronic devices has spurred significant innovation in fuse housing designs. Traditionally, fuse brackets were bulky, occupying considerable extent on circuit boards. However, modern electronics necessitate reduced solutions. Recent advancements include surface-mount technology (SMT) fastenings featuring exceptionally small footprints, often incorporating integrated joints to simplify assembly. Another trend involves the use of engineered molded bodies with precisely engineered cavities to ensure secure fuse retention while minimizing overall volume. Furthermore, some designs incorporate bouncy mechanisms for easy fuse swap – a critical factor for maintainability in field applications, although this frequently adds to the combined measurements. A crucial consideration is ensuring adequate infrared dissipation, especially when dealing with high-current safety devices, which is often addressed through thermally conductive agents in the shell.

Fastener-Type Current Box Construction
The attachment-type circuit box module represents a robust and reliable method for protecting electrical circuits, particularly favored in factory applications. Unlike regular voltage blocks, these units utilize a fastener mechanism to secure the overcurrent units into their respective spaces, ensuring a firm and unfailing connection.
